About replies on Threads
You can add to a discussion by replying to a post on Threads. When you reply to a post, your reply will appear as its own thread in the replies tab on your profile and people will be able to reply to it.
Note: Private profiles can only reply to their followers on Threads. If you have a public profile, anyone on or off Threads can see your replies. Learn more about the differences between public and private profiles.
Reply to a post
Threads app for Android and iPhone
  1. Tap reply or Reply to [username] below the post you want to reply to. Note: If a private profile you don’t follow replies to you, you won’t be able to see their reply.
  2. Enter your reply. You can also tap:
    • gallery to attach a photo or video to your reply. You can select up to 10 items to attach.
    • gifs to include a GIF in your reply.
    • voice to include a voice recording in your reply. Tap the red button to begin recording. Once you’re done recording, tap the red button again. Your reply will include both the voice recording and text of the voice recording.
    • poll to add a poll to your reply.
  3. To choose who can reply to your thread, tap Anyone can reply in the bottom left. You can limit who can reply to Profiles you follow or Mentioned only.
  4. Tap Post in the bottom right.
Keep in mind
  • If someone replies to you and you delete your post, their reply won’t be deleted.
  • If you and the author of the post have both turned on sharing to the fediverse, a message will appear at the top, as you’re drafting your reply, to indicate that your reply to the post will be shared with users on other servers.
  • Your replies won’t appear on other fediverse servers if the format of the post you’re replying to isn’t supported or the post limits who can reply to it.
